Symptoms of Glaucoma: The symptoms of glaucoma can vary depending on the type and severity of the condition. However, some common signs to look out for include:

  • Loss of peripheral vision
  • Blurred vision
  • Eye pain or redness
  • Halos around lights
  • Nausea or vomiting

Causes of Glaucoma: Glaucoma is caused by increased pressure within the eye, which can damage the optic nerve and lead to vision loss. There are two main types of glaucoma: open-angle glaucoma and closed-angle glaucoma. Open-angle glaucoma is more common and often develops slowly over time, while closed-angle glaucoma can occur suddenly and require immediate treatment.

Treatment of Glaucoma: While there is no cure for glaucoma, there are several treatment options available to manage the condition and prevent further vision loss. These may include:

  • Eye drops to reduce intraocular pressure
  • Laser surgery to improve fluid drainage in the eye
  • Conventional surgery to create a new drainage channel in the eye
